So you only acquired your row property for $35,000 in Mayfair, and after $2000 in closing prices and $5000 in fix prices, you find yourself a very good tenant who wants to hire the home. Just after renting the house having a beneficial money stream of $200 a month, you now have An impressive financial debt of $forty two,000 on your property equity line of credit rating that must be paid out off. When obtaining the home, I didn't receive a mortgage loan as I just purchased a home for hard cash because it is alleged inside the business. All monies I put in on this house have been spent through the home-fairness line of credit.

The go now is to pay back your house-fairness line of credit so you're able to go get it done once more. We now visit a bank using your fixed-up house and tell the mortgage Section that you would like to perform a cash-out refinancing of the housing expense. It can help to explain the community you purchase your residence in should have a broader number of pricing because the community of Mayfair did in the mid-90s. The pricing of properties in Mayfair is quite abnormal as you would probably see a $3000 distinction in property values from one block to the following. This was significant when performing a dollars-out refinancing because it's fairly effortless with the bank to view that I just purchased my residence for $35,000 whatever the proven fact that I did quite a few repairs. I could justify The point that I've put in extra money on my dwelling to fix it up, and by putting a tenant in, it was now a financially rewarding bit of property from an financial commitment standpoint.

If I had been lucky like I was over and over about doing this system of purchasing residences in Mayfair as well as appraiser would use houses a block or two away and come back using an appraisal of $forty five,000. Again then there have been applications enabling an Trader to invest in a house for 10 % down or still left in as fairness doing a 90 percent income out refinance offering me back again about $forty,500. Utilizing This method permitted me to have again most of the funds I place down to the assets. I basically paid just $1,500 down for this new home. Why did the mortgage loan firms as well as the appraisers retain giving me the numbers I needed? I suppose because they needed the business. I would only tell the bank I need this to come in at $45,000 or I'm just holding it financed as is. They constantly looked as if it would give me what I wanted within rationale.

This entire method took 3 to 4 months all through which time I may have saved a few thousand bucks. Involving the money I saved from my work and my investments and hard cash out refinancing, I'd replenished most or all of my resources from my dwelling-fairness line of credit history which was now Just about again to zero to start the method yet again. And that's what exactly I meant to do. I employed This technique to buy four to six houses a year utilizing the same money to invest in dwelling immediately after home immediately after house over and over again.
